Assignment of the Auberger red cell antigen polymorphism to the Lutheran blood group system: genetic justification
T Zelinski1, H Kaita, G Coghlan
1Department of Pediatrics and Child Health, University of Manitoba, Winnipeg, Canada.
Abstract:
Family studies have provided the final piece of evidence for the assignment of Auberger to the Lutheran blood group system. Lods derived from combined paternal and maternal meioses (zeta = 10.83 at theta = 0.00) strongly support the contention that a single gene controls the expression of both Au and LU antigens. Consequently, the International Society of Blood Transfusion Working Party on Terminology has designated Aua and Aub as LU18 and LU19, respectively.
